In the article, the author considers the concepts of "feedback" and "trust" in the context of the working environment. Attention is focused on the interaction of the head and subordinate in the situation of a pandemic. The influence of the manager's feedback on the employee's level of trust is analyzed. Recommendations for the process of providing feedback are given, which help to increase the trust of the subordinate to the manager in a situation of remote work with an increased level of anxiety.

The relevance of the study is determined by the importance of preschool age for the organization of interpersonal interaction, the need to develop leadership abilities in older preschool age. The purpose of the study is to identify the characteristics of the empathy manifestation in children of older preschool age with different levels of leadership abilities. According to the results of the study, it was established that children-leaders have a high level of the development of empathy emotional and behavioral components; children with an average and low level of leadership abilities have an average level of emotional and behavioral manifestations of empathy.
